Transaction 461a59c1553e99739b3ebd3a5a36adb42a3dec2470158a5d89cef6aae7655347

4 Input
1 Outputs
  • 461a59c1553e99739b3ebd3a5a36adb42a3dec2470158a5d89cef6aae7655347:0
  • value  17704875
    address  136ZRfxTsjKSJYcAcydAuQAcDYraDQ9xYr